Well. This book was a gothic creepfest. My biggest gripe is the repeated use of the g slur as well as the use of the terrible stereotype of the Romani people. I cannot help but to think that the author attempted to keep the book laced in the time it is set, but it still doesn’t sit right with me. Despite that, everything else was great. Growing creepiness and an unreliable narrator, as well as all the deception within the book. Fantastic.
